Trading in the forex market can be lucrative, but it’s also rife with dishonest schemes. To protect your hard-earned money, you need to learn how to spot fake forex brokers. These bogus entities prey on unsuspecting traders by offering appealing promises of quick riches and assured profits.
However, their true motive is to defraud your funds and disappear without a trace. Here are some red flags to watch out for:
- Unregulated brokers: A legitimate forex broker will always be regulated by a reputable financial authority. Do your research and verify the broker’s credentials before you deposit any money.
- Inflated returns: Be wary of brokers who promise unrealistic returns or guarantee profits. In reality, forex trading is inherently volatile.
- Coercion tactics: Legitimate brokers won’t pressure you into making quick decisions or depositing large sums of money. They will educate you about the risks involved and allow you to invest at your own pace.
- Lack of transparency: A trustworthy broker will be open about its fees, trading platform, and customer service policies. If a broker is evasive or neglects to provide clear information, it’s a major red flag.
Remember, when it comes to forex trading, security should always be your top priority. Don’t get blinded by promises of easy money; instead, do your due diligence and choose a legitimate broker that prioritizes your best interests.

Is Your Broker Legit? The Ultimate Guide to Verification
Navigating the complexities of the financial world can be challenging. Choosing the right broker is vital, and confirming their legitimacy is a essential step.
A trustworthy broker will emphasize transparency and provide you with the tools you need to make informed decisions. Here's your ultimate guide to ensuring your broker is on the up and up.
- Research their background: Check for regulatory licenses from reputable bodies like the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A).
- Review online feedback: Get perspectives from other investors.
- Analyze their rates: Look for unexplained costs that could reduce your gains.
- Reach out to their customer assistance: Assess their efficiency in addressing your questions.
By following these tips, you can reduce the risk of encountering a fraudulent broker and protect your financial well-being.
